Inspiration
Just simple, fun, effective, and fun. Mixing a bit of hardware and software. I really like the idea of using dynamic data to affect a local environment.
How it works
The program loops polling the motion sensor, when triggered it text-to-speech's a random pool of text. The text is pulled from twitter with a designated tag. Tweet data is filtered, de-duped, and appended to a growing local flatfile json storing system.
Challenges I ran into
iwconfig doesn't like citrix's open wireless network. Can't really download packages without internet. Had to go offsite to download needed packages. Otherwise there was nothing really overwhelming in terms of software/hardware. oAuth process takes a bit of time to understand.
Accomplishments that I'm proud of
Python is fun to work with. Made the process quick and easy. Had a lot of fun with buddies researching libraries and options.
What I learned
Gained more knowledge about linux based wireless tools, python, and oAuth.
What's next for Twitter Doorbot
Twitter Voicemail Bot 9001. Use this concept to make a 'voicemail' sort of system. IoT status. It's happening.
Built With
- espeak
- json
- lil-john
- linux
- motion-sensor
- python
- raspberry-pi
- twython






Log in or sign up for Devpost to join the conversation.